A rectangular piece of cardboard, 100 cm by 40 cm, is going to be used to make a rectangular box with an open top by cutting congruent squares from the corners. Calculate the dimensions (to one decimal place) for a box with the largest volume.5. A rectangular piece of land is to be fenced using two kinds of fencing. Two opposite sides will be fenced using standard fencing that costs $6/m, while the other two sides will require heavy-duty fencing that costs $9/m. What are the dimensions of the rectangular lot of greatest area that can be fenced for a cost of $9000
